Carpet Pad Water Extraction Cost In Highland Village, TX

The cost of Carpet Pad Water Extraction in Highland Village, TX, can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our team will provide you with a detailed estimate of the costs involved, so you can make an informed decision about your restoration project.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Initial Assessment and Planning $100 – $500 The severity of the damage and the size of the affected area
Water Extraction $500 – $2,500 The amount of water extracted and the equipment used
Drying and Dehumidification $500 – $2,000 The size of the affected area and the equipment used
Sanitizing and Disinfecting $200 – $1,000 The size of the affected area and the equipment used
Final Inspection and Cleanup $100 – $500 The size of the affected area and the equipment used

The prices listed above are estimates, and the actual cost of Carpet Pad Water Extraction in Highland Village, TX, may vary depending on your specific situation.
